Rejuvenate
I've finally got this skill - yay!!
Question: Should I empower 5 points into cool down for this? Original cool down is 10 seconds, after 5 points, the cool down is 7 seconds. I know it's only 3 second difference, but you know how sometimes 3 seconds in game is a lot when there's an intense healing session.
I want to empower 5 points into sp consumption to this (I wanna do the exact same empowerments as my normal heal on this skill). Is it worth it? Do people use this skill often? Or should I save it for other skills?

Rejuvenation is a useful skill, you can cast it during the gap between Heals for maximum efficiency. However, please keep in mind that Rejuvenation has a cast time, so Rejuvenation is not a skill you would depend your life on.

Heal and Rejuvenate stack very well. If you run into serious trouble, Heal + Rejuvenate provide close to 2k hp restored in about 2 seconds.
Cooldown shouldn't really be empowered, but I did do 5 points into SP Consumption.
